As far as gestures, accidental pinch-zoom was my worst challenge. It was hard to avoid, and it would trigger my migraines. I understand why small screens need easy scrolling and zooming gestures, it's just I need an option to disable them. Accidental taps were also annoying, of course.

Excessive red can be a problem:

With epilepsy-- https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/10487169

Without-- https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/9163847

Blue-tinted sunglasses can help a bit too.

A lot of styli are designed for a type of grip I can't use. A touchscreen glove should avoid that, but I'm allergic to latex and spandex, and have had trouble with gloves advertised as 100% cotton which turn out to be 2% spandex.
